NCT ID: NCT05484609 Completed - Clinical trials for Access to Primary Care

Access to Primary Care for People With Opioid Use Disorder

Start date: June 1, 2021
Phase: N/A
Study type: Interventional

Background: Access to high quality primary care is essential for health, particularly for vulnerable populations. Research indicates, however, that people with opioid use disorder (OUD), are less likely than others to have a primary care provider. The reasons are unclear, but may be related to patient factors, system barriers and provider factors, including discrimination. Research goal: Our primary goal is to determine if discrimination by primary care physicians plays a role in poor access to primary care for those in treatment for OUD. The answers will help researchers and policy-makers find ways to improve access to primary care for this vulnerable population. Research question: Are people in treatment for OUD less likely to be offered a new patient appointment with a physician compared to those in treatment for diabetes? Overall study design: In this randomized controlled trial (RCT), the investigators will make unannounced phone calls to primary care physicians' practices to ask for a new patient appointment. Physicians will be randomly assigned to one of two clinical scenarios: a patient with diabetes, or a patient in treatment for OUD. Our outcome measure is an unconditional offer of a new patient appointment with the physician contacted or with another physician at the same practice. In an secondary analysis the investigators will determine the impact of physician gender, years in practice, rurality and model of care on offers of a new patient appointment. Participants: Randomly-selected primary care physicians in Ontario. Data analysis methods: The investigators will use chi-squared test and logistic regression to determine if there is a statistically and clinically significant difference in the proportions of offering a new patient appointment between the two clinical scenarios.

NCT ID: NCT05479656 Completed - Clinical trials for Autosomal Recessive Spastic Ataxia of Charlevoix-Saguenay

A Rehabilitation Program to Increase Balance and Mobility in Ataxia of Charlevoix-Saguenay

Start date: May 13, 2019
Phase: N/A
Study type: Interventional

This exploratory study used a pre-post test design. The supervised rehabilitation program was performed three times a week for 8 weeks (two sessions at a rehabilitation gym and one pool session). Outcome measures included Ottawa sitting scale, 30-Second Chair Stand test, Berg Balance Scale, 10-Meter Walk Test, 6-minute Walk Test, modified Activities-specific Balance Confidence Scale and SARA scale. 10 participants will complete the training program. They will be evaluated at baseline, at week 4 (miway) and after the program.

NCT ID: NCT05478252 Completed - Clinical trials for Diabetes Mellitus, Type 2

A Research Study to Compare Two Semaglutide Medicines in People With Type 2 Diabetes

Start date: August 3, 2022
Phase: Phase 3
Study type: Interventional

The study compares two semaglutide medicines and looks at how well they control blood sugar levels, in participants with type 2 diabetes (T2D). Participants will either get the currently available semaglutide or the semaglutide which is produced through a new manufacturing process. Participants need to take one injection of semaglutide once a week, on the same day of every week. Participants will have a total of 11 clinic visits and the study will last for about 35 weeks (approximately 8 months).

NCT ID: NCT05476861 Completed - Type 1 Diabetes Clinical Trials

Insulin Omission Surrogate (iOS)

iOS
Start date: November 1, 2022
Phase:
Study type: Observational

Type 1 Diabetes management is requiring and implies numerous lifestyle modifications. Insulin restriction to control weight is a frequent phenomenon, affecting up to 40% of PWT1D. Broadly, purging or binge eating behaviors are also frequently disordered eating behaviors (DEB) in people living with a Type 1 Diabetes (associated or not with restrictive eating behaviors). In a study on adolescents with T1D, the prevalence of moderate or high level of DEB ranged from 21% to 32%. Moreover, the presence of binge eating behavior seems to be associated with higher anxiety and depression levels. Omitting insulin for weight control has been associated with the highest rates of retinopathy and nephropathy when compared to other weight control behaviors and to increase the risk of mortality by 3.2 times and decrease life spans from an average of 58 to 44 years at 11-year follow-up. Moreover, insulin misuse may be much more complex behavior than just the need for weight control. These behaviors may also involve increased distress, loss of control, and feelings of regret, guilt, and shame. Interestingly, most studies of eating disorders and type 1 diabetes use question regarding insulin omission as a surrogate marker for eating disorders and disordered eating. For instance, the question used in the BETTER registry are: "In the past 12 months, did you intentionally omit insulin injections with the objective of losing weight?" or "In a typical week, how often do you miss an insulin dose?". However, the validity and robustness of such a marker have not been specifically investigated yet. Our study objectives are : 1) To confirm that participants who reported intentionally omitting insulin had significantly more disordered eating behavior (based on the review of food records available); 2) To compare the prevalence and the severity of physical and mental health comorbidities (e.g., diabetes micro and macrovascular complications, glycated hemoglobin levels, current and past psychiatric disorders, distress related to diabetes) in people living with diabetes having or not declared to intentionally omit insulin; 3) To establish, using machine learning techniques, the main factors associated with intentional insulin omission behavior, taking into account biological, anthropometric and psychometric factors.

NCT ID: NCT05468281 Completed - Atrial Fibrillation Clinical Trials

RAFF5 Proposal: Improve the Quality and Safety of Patients Seen in the Emergency Department for Acute Atrial Fibrillation and Flutter

RAFF5
Start date: September 1, 2022
Phase:
Study type: Observational

Acute atrial fibrillation (AF) and flutter (AFL) are the most common arrhythmias requiring management in the emergency department (ED). They are characterized by sudden onset of a rapid heart rate which may be irregular (AF) or regular (AFL). Our focus is on episodes of acute AF or AFL which are usually less than 48 hours in duration and are highly symptomatic, requiring rapid treatment in the ED. Management guidelines for acute AF/AFL have changed substantially in recent years with several recent revisions published by the Canadian Cardiovascular Society (CCS) and the Canadian Association of Emergency Physicians (CAEP). The 2021 CAEP Acute Atrial Fibrillation/Flutter Best Practices Checklist (CAEP Checklist) was very recently published to assist ED physicians in Canada and elsewhere manage patients who present to the ED with acute AF/AFL (Figure 1). The overall goal of this project is to improve the quality and safety of the immediate and subsequent care of patients seen in the ED with acute AF and AFL by implementing the principles of the CAEP Checklist at both The Ottawa Hospital (TOH) EDs and by working with TOH cardiologists to provide rapid cardiology follow-up processes for patients discharged from the ED. The Investigators propose a before-after cohort study using an interrupted time series design to evaluate implementation involving 720 patients at the two TOH EDs over a 24-month period.
